    Ash are a Northern Irish rock band formed in Downpatrick, County Down in 1992 by vocalist and guitarist Tim Wheeler, bassist Mark Hamilton and drummer Rick McMurray. As a three-piece, they released mini-album Trailer in 1994 and full-length album 1977 in 1996. This 1996 release was named by NME as one of the 500 greatest albums of all time. [8]

    In March 2021, Ashe released another song with O'Connell titled "Till Forever Falls Apart". Her debut album Ashlyn was released on May 7, 2021, including the songs "I'm Fine" and "When I'm Older" issued prior to the album, along with "Me Without You", released on May 5. Ashlyn debuted at number 194 on the Billboard 200 dated May 22, 2021. [31]

    Free All Angels is the third studio album to be recorded by Northern Irish rock band Ash.It was released on 23 April 2001 through Infectious Records and Home Grown. Due to the mixed reaction to the band's second studio album Nu-Clear Sounds (1998), frontman Tim Wheeler suffered from depression.

    Drowned in Sound reviewer Marc Burrows called Islands "unmistakably, from the very first note, a new Ash album" that was Ash's "most consistently enjoyable full-length record since Free All Angels." He liked Wheeler's "knack for an earworm", which often "deliver[ed] three or four velcro hooks per-song". [33]
